1938 - 2007
James (John) William Wolverton at the age of 69 passed away on Wednesday, August 29, 2007 in Comfort, Texas. He was born on May 11, 1938 in Pragg City, Mo. to Noah Wolverton and Pauline Collins Wolverton. John married Marthie Gene Farris on Aug. 23, 1964 in KY. He worked as a truck driver his whole life. He is preceded in death by his parents.
John is survived by his wife of 42 years Marthie Wolverton of Comfort; children Jimmy Wolverton, Joe Wolverton, Jimmy Wolverton, Gail Wolverton, Tessia War, Regina Orkens, Rhonda War, and Shelia Barules; brother Joe Wolverton; sister Novella Baccus; 12 grandchildren and numbers great grandchildren; best friend Jean Day and many other family members and friends who love him will miss him.
No services at this time.
